I was not stating that service mapping was insecure, what I was suggesting is that fluorine should be default block all services that are not explicitly names in a service mapping configuration. Developer, being developers often forget things, and before you know it, someone will have figured out the services in a developers page and be using services that were not intended for public consumption to destroy data. I do software security for a living and file holes in software all the time from seasoned developers.
